background Taylor Jay [ xtaylorjayx ] Onlyfans leaked video 14284184 on Hotleaks.tv play icon

Taylor Jay [ xtaylorjayx ] Onlyfans leaked video 14284184

Peeka boobs💋💋
1.1M views・ 1 year ago
View More
Back to Top